Ford May Name Mulally's Successor

Ford Motor Co.'s board of directors is meeting this Thursday and CEO succession could be on the agenda.
Bloomberg reported Tuesday that the directors are close to promoting Mark Fields to chief operating officer. The report quoted an unnamed source.
The promotion would make Fields the probable successor to 67-year-old CEO Alan Mulally.
Ford said the report was speculative and wouldn't confirm it. But the company said it takes succession seriously and has a plan in place for each of its leadership positions.
Mulally is revered at Ford for turning the company around after he was hired in 2006. He has never said publicly when he will retire, but Ford is under pressure to prove it can keep its turnaround on track even after he leaves.
